Ingredients

– 1 pound of chicken livers
– 1 onion, finely chopped
– 2 cloves of garlic, minced
– 1/2 cup of heavy cream
– 1/2 cup of unsalted butter, divided
– 2 tablespoons of brandy or cognac
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Fresh thyme leaves
– Clarified butter for sealing

Directions

1. In a skillet,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ium heat. Add the finely chopped onion and garlic, cooking until translucent.
2. Add the chicken livers to the skillet and cook until browned on the outside but slightly pink on the inside.
3. Pour in the brandy or cognac and let it simmer for a minute to allow the alcohol to cook off.
4. Season the mixture with salt, pepper, and fresh thyme leaves. Remove the skillet from heat and let it cool slightly.
5. Transfer the liver mixture to a food processor and add the remaining butter and heavy cream. Blend until smooth and creamy.
6.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ary.
7. Spoon the pâté into ramekins or jars, smoothing the top with a spatula.
8. Melt the clarified butter and pour a thin layer over the pâté to seal and preserve it.
9. Refrigerate for at least a few hours to allow the flavors to meld together.
10. Serve chilled with toasted bread or crackers.

FAQs About Chicken Liver Pâté

What is Chicken Liver Pâté?

Chicken liver pâté is a smooth and creamy spread made from cooked chicken livers, butter, herbs, and sometimes alcohol like cognac or brandy. It is a popular French appetizer known for its rich flavor and silky texture.

How is Chicken Liver Pâté Served?

Chicken liver pâté is typically served on toasted bread or crackers as an appetizer. It can also be used as a filling for pastries or as a topping for meats. The versatility of chicken liver pâté makes it a beloved choice for various culinary creations.

What are the Key Ingredients in Chicken Liver Pâté?

The main ingredients in chicken liver pâté include chicken livers, butter, onions, garlic, herbs (such as thyme and parsley), and sometimes cognac or brandy for added depth of flavor. These ingredients are blended together to create the smooth and flavorful pâté.

Is Chicken Liver Pâté Nutritious?

Chicken liver is a good source of protein, iron, and vitamins A and B12. However, due to the high butter content in pâté, it is considered a high-calorie and high-fat food. Moderation is key when enjoying this delicious delicacy.
